Thank you very much for replying. I tried to figure out how to get this contrast work to test the overall hypothesis AB-A/2-B/2=0. Setting weights for factor Genotype and predicting DPP gives me the results per DPP-level. I am interested primarily in the overall picture.
What I did is:

 pred <- predict.asreml( asr, classify="DPP", present=list("Genotype", prwts=c(-.5,1, -.5)))

according to your suggestion. At least I understood it that way. Is there way to get the result I want with ASReml-R or do I have to use the standalone version of ASReml?
